Description
The SMTP component in Microsoft Windows 2000 SP4 XP SP2 and SP3 Server 2003 SP2 and Server 2008 Gold SP2 and R2 and Exchange Server 2000 SP3 does not properly allocate memory for SMTP command replies which allows remote attackers to read fragments of e-mail messages by sending a series of invalid commands and then sending a STARTTLS command aka \SMTP Memory Allocation Vulnerability.\
